Install Web Server dan Multiprogramming pada OS Linux

Nama : I Nyoman Tri Aditya
NIM : 1705551117
Mata Kuliah : Network Operating System
Dosen : I Putu Agus Eka Pratama, S.T.,M.T
Jurusan Teknologi Informasi, Fakultas Teknik, Universtitas Udayana

Instalasi Web Server

Linux adalah salah satu sistem operasi yang banyak digunakan dikalangan developer, selain lisensinya yang gratis dan banyak aplikasi opensource yang membantu developer dalam mengerjakan projectnya. Secara umum linux itu terbagi menjadi beberapa distro/ keturunan linux seperti ubuntu ,debian , open suse dan lain lain. dan xampp adalah salah satu paket webserver yang mendukung untuk 3 operasi yaitu windows, linux dan macOS.

Cara install xampp di linux dan windows itu berbeda karna di linux instalasinya tidak hanya dengan double click melainkan dengan cara lainya, bisa secara online dan secara offline, pada tutorial kali ini kita akan coba menggunakan terminal untuk melakukan modifikasi hak akses pada file xampp yang akan kita install



Berikut langkah - langkah instalasi xampp pada linux via terminal;
  1. Download xampp terbaru disini
  2. Buka Terminal linux
  3. Berikan hak akses dengan perintah sudo chmod +x namafile.run
  4. Jalankan file tersebut dengan perintah sudo ./namafile.run
  5. Xampp berhasil diinstal, jalankan XAMPP dengan perintah sudo opt/lampp/lampp start
  6. Kamu juga bisa membuka window aplikasi xampp dengan perintah sudo /opt/lampp/manager-linux-x64.run 
Terkadang terdapat error setelah berhasil menjalankan xampp. Error yang sering ditemukan seperti Mysql dan Apache Web Server tidak bisa dijalankan 

MySql dan Apache stopping



 Berikut cara mengatasi eror Mysql dan Apache tidak bisa berjalan
MySql : sudo mysql service stop
Apache : sudo apachectl stop
Kemudian klik start kembali pada window xampp atau dengan perintah sudo /opt/lampp/lampp start, maka semua service pada xampp dapat berjalan normal

Service pada xampp running

Multiproccess/Multiprogramming Top dan Htop

  1. Jalankan sebanyak mungkin aplikasi pada sistem operasi linux secara bersamaan, seperti multimedia,office,game,video,browser,terminal,dll
  2. Buka terminal lalu ketik perintah top dan htop. Amati prosesnya
Perintah Top

Perintah Htop
Terlihat pada perintah top tasks yang berjalan berjumlah 245 sedangkan pada htop 151. Kemudian pada bagian command pada perintah top, list yang ditampilkan beragam dari tasks yang sedang berjalan sedangkan pada perintah htop hanya terdapat command dari task xampp. Ini berarti perintah htop digunakan mengontrol dan mengawasi web server sedangkan perintah top digunakan untuk melihat command apa saja yang sedang berjalan pada sistem operasi linux

Komentar

Postingan populer dari blog ini

Flowchart

Tipe Data dan karakter khusus C++

Instalasi dan Review Linux Ubuntu 16.04 LTS